Is anyone out there using a either an ipad air 1 or nvidia shield K1 tablet with their Mavic 2? I have read threads of issues with older ipad's but I really don't fond too much info on the shield. I have been using my phone mostly but would love to have a bigger screen and have these tablets laying around for dedicated drone usage if they'll work. Thanks
 
I use the Nvidia K1 with my Mavic Pro and it a very good tablet to fly with although the screen brightness is not technically sunlight readable. Battery Life is also not stellar, but no issues running DJIGO4. No crashes of the app and no slowdowns with video signal.

The app has put on weight and the K1 is not as good as it used to be.
The Huawei M3 & M5 are now the best Android tablets for flying with the app.
Fast to boot and they run the app flawlessly + they have a good speaker so you can hear any alerts.

I'm currently using an iPad Air First Generation on a Skyreat tablet mount. The Air runs DJI Go 4.0 flawlessly for me and I love the extra 'real estate' the screen size affords. Works well on the Skyreat tablet holder too.

Thanks, the iPad I have is my wife's old tablet that'll be dedicated to the drone. I just couldn't justify a new tablet just to use for flying.
 
The First Gen Air will still run DJI Go 4.0 well, especially if you use it as a dedicated tablet for the drone and don't have loads of other apps installed which may potentially slow it down.
